Capital rolls out multi-layer security for R-Day

The Delhi Police have geared up for Republic Day celebration with over 50,000 security personnel deployed across the Capital especially in New Delhi, Central and North district.

The police said that over 3,500 officers from the three districts and 7,200 additional cops have been roped in from the remaining 11 districts of which 600 are women officers.

“At least 1,000 CCTV cameras have been installed at prominent places to keep a tight vigil. Dog squads have also been deployed at market areas,” said Delhi Police Public Relations Officer Madhur Verma.

Not only Delhi Police, 63 companies of Paramilitary force have also been deployed along with 300 ITBP commandos and 200 NSG commandos. The police said that 450 door frame metal detectors have been set up for security checks and vehicular blockades for smooth movement.

Traffic police personnel will be deployed in large numbers to ensure “minimum inconvenience” and “maximum facilitation”.

The entry and exit from Central Secretariat and Udyog metro stations will be closed from 5 a.m. till 12 noon today. The entry and exit from metro stations Lok Kalyan Marg (formerly known as Race Course) and Patel Chowk will be closed from 8.45 a.m. till 12 noon.
